What Actually Happens in LGSF Construction (On Ground)

To understand LGSF properly, you have to stop thinking of it as “construction” in the traditional sense. It’s closer to assembly than building.

The entire structure is first designed digitally. Every wall panel, every window opening, every connection is mapped out in detail. There is very little guesswork left for the site.

Once the design is finalized:

  • Steel coils are processed into thin sections
  • These sections are shaped into C and U profiles
  • Components are cut and labeled
  • Everything is transported to the site

At the site, the job becomes straightforward—assemble according to plan.

This changes a lot of things:

  • Less dependency on individual labour skill
  • Less adjustment during execution
  • Less confusion on-site

With LGSF construction India, the real work happens before the site work begins. And that’s why the site itself feels more controlled. Why People Still Get Confused Between LGSF and PEB

This confusion is very common. People hear “steel construction” and immediately think everything is the same. Most of this confusion comes from not clearly understanding what is PEB structure and how its purpose differs from LGSF.

So, when you compare LGSF vs PEB, the difference becomes clear very quickly.

PEB (Pre-Engineered Buildings) is designed for:

  • Large warehouses
  • Industrial sheds
  • Factories with wide spans

These structures use heavy steel sections. They are built to carry heavy loads and cover large areas without internal columns.

LGSF is completely different in approach.

It is used for:

  • Houses
  • Low-rise buildings
  • Modular structures

Instead of heavy beams and columns, it focuses on wall framing systems made from lightweight steel.

So the difference is not just in size—it’s in how the building behaves.

  • PEB gives you open industrial space.
  • LGSF gives you structured, room-based layouts.

What Changes When You Actually Build Using LGSF

The biggest difference is not technical—it’s practical. The workflow changes.

In traditional construction, everything is sequential. One task depends on another. Delays happen because something is always pending.

In LGSF:

  • Walls are assembled quickly
  • Services like plumbing and electrical can be pre-planned
  • Finishing starts earlier than usual

There is less idle time. But this doesn’t mean it’s effortless. It just means the work is better planned.

LGSF Construction Cost — Why It’s Not a Straight Answer

Cost is always the first question. And honestly, it’s also the most misunderstood part.

When people ask about light gauge framing cost in India, they usually expect a fixed rate. But construction doesn’t work that way. At first glance, LGSF might seem slightly higher than basic RCC in material terms.

But then you notice:

  • Construction finishes faster
  • Labour costs are lower
  • Rework is minimal
  • Time-related costs reduce

So the real comparison is not just material—it’s the entire project cycle. And in many cases, the difference becomes much smaller than expected.

Where LGSF Can Be a Challenge

This is something most blogs don’t talk about, but it matters. LGSF requires planning upfront.

You cannot keep changing things during construction like in traditional methods. Decisions need to be taken earlier. For some people, this feels restrictive. For others, it actually improves clarity and reduces confusion.

Also, availability of experienced teams can be a factor in certain regions. Since the method is still growing in India, not everyone is equally familiar with it.

1. Is LGSF construction strong enough for Indian conditions?

Yes, it is. The steel used in LGSF is designed to handle structural loads and environmental conditions. When properly designed and installed, it performs well even in areas with wind or seismic activity.

2. Is LGSF cheaper than traditional construction?

Not always in direct material cost, but when you consider faster construction, reduced labour, and fewer delays, the overall project cost often becomes comparable or even more efficient.

3. Can I build a normal house using LGSF in India?

Yes, many residential houses and villas are now being built using LGSF. It works well for low-rise structures and gives flexibility in design and faster completion.

4. What is the main difference between LGSF and PEB?

PEB is mainly used for large industrial buildings like warehouses, while LGSF is more suitable for residential and smaller commercial structures. The difference is in purpose, not just material.

5. Does LGSF require special contractors or skills?

Yes, it does require teams who understand the system properly. Since the process is more design-driven, working with experienced professionals makes a big difference in execution quality.
